In this episode of The SPAC Podcast, James shares how the investor base for de-SPACs has shifted and why sponsors must focus on attracting long-term, fundamental investors. James explains that while redemption risk is always present, the āunicornā is the fundamental investor who buys in between announcement and closing. He notes that some of the most successful deals heās worked on, those with minimal or no redemptions, were anchored by strong institutions like Putnam and Par Capital that believed in the long-term story. The lesson? Sponsors need to think less about avoiding redemptions and more about targeting fundamental investors who want to own the business beyond the merger.
